Output 8073a6187b95f75c2c9b5352d0e4b71c0375ee30c218593313f49c8be0e6492b:1

value
352810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50f4c9f02d4c6ac9999b6a8680ddc6c2904341d7 OP_EQUAL
address
3955E7fJ8Mx7VT92unzQRv5ZuZGSvbFzYq
transaction
8073a6187b95f75c2c9b5352d0e4b71c0375ee30c218593313f49c8be0e6492b
spent
true